FCA zones in on crypto transfers in money laundering crackdown

So-called Travel Rule will force digital asset firms to check international transfers

Firms told to 'take all reasonable steps to comply'
Firms told to 'take all reasonable steps to comply' Photo: Alamy

The UK's markets watchdog continues to crack down on money laundering, with crypto firms doing international transfers the latest to be put under the spotlight.

The so-called Travel Rule comes into force on 1 September, requiring crypto firms in the UK to collect, verify and share information about where funds come from and who the beneficiaries are.
